java九九乘法表程序
时间: 2024-06-12 12:10:01 浏览: 78
以下是Java实现九九乘法表的程序:
```
public class MultiplicationTable {
public static void main(String[] args) {
for (int i = 1; i <= 9; i++) {
for (int j = 1; j <= i; j++) {
System.out.print(j + "×" + i + "=" + (i * j) + "\t");
}
System.out.println();
}
}
}
```
相关问题
java九九乘法表程序whlie
在Java中,你可以使用while循环结合嵌套循环来生成九九乘法表。这是一个简单的示例:
```java
public class MultiplicationTable {
public static void main(String[] args) {
int i = 1;
while (i <= 9) {
int j = 1;
while (j <= i) {
System.out.print(j + " * " + i + " = " + (j * i) + "\t");
j++;
}
// 每次打印完一行,换到下一行
System.out.println();
i++;
}
}
}
```
这个程序会从1开始,每次循环内部的`j`都会自增,直到等于外部的`i`。然后它会打印出`j`乘以`i`的结果,并在每个数字之间加上制表符`\t`使得结果对齐。当`j`达到`i`后,会换行并增加外部的`i`,继续下一个乘法规则。
java九九乘法表程序计算空格
在Java中编写一个九九乘法表程序,并控制输出的空格,可以按照下面的方式完成:
```java
public class MultiplicationTable {
public static void main(String[] args) {
for (int i = 1; i <= 9; i++) {
// 对于每一行,除了第一个数和最后一个数外,其他数字之间都打印一个空格
for (int j = 1; j < i; j++) {
System.out.print(" ");
}
// 打印每个数及其对应的乘积
for (int k = 1; k <= i; k++) {
System.out.print(k + " * " + i + " = " + i * k + "\t");
}
// 每一行结束后换行
System.out.println();
}
}
}
```
在这个程序里,我们首先通过两个嵌套循环遍历乘法表中的每一个元素。内部循环用于打印空格,使得数字之间的间距看起来像乘法表。外部循环则控制行数,每行结束后都会打印一个换行符`println()`,开始下一行。
运行这个程序,你会得到一个带适当空格的九九乘法表。
阅读全文